It's essential to know what facilities are at your disposal when visiting a train station, and Kirkham & Wesham has a range of them to ensure your journey is smooth. The station is fully equipped with ticket buying options including a ticket office open Monday from 06:40 to 17:45, and on Sunday from 08:30 to 16:15. For on-the-go travelers, ticket machines are available for purchasing and collecting tickets, with accessible options to suit those with mobility challenges.
For your convenience, an induction loop is installed to assist those with hearing impairments. The station features CCTV for enhanced safety, although note that there are no dedicated luggage storage facilities. While Kirkham & Wesham doesn’t offer waiting rooms, it does provide ample seating areas. Accessibility is a priority here, with step-free access throughout, making it categorized as a Category A and scooter-friendly station. However, certain amenities such as refreshment facilities, shops, and public Wi-Fi are not available on-site, so plan accordingly.
Kirkham & Wesham Station is not just about trains; it also boasts robust transport links making it easy to switch between different transport modes. Rail replacement services can be accessed at bus stops conveniently located on the bridge outside the station. Though there isn't a taxi rank at the station, this link offers details about booking local taxi services. For regular bus services, you can call Busline at 0871 200 2233 for further information.

St Austell station offers a range of facilities designed to enhance the convenience and comfort of all travelers. With a ticket office open from 07:30 to 19:00 on weekdays and Saturdays and slightly reduced hours on Sundays, purchasing and collecting train tickets is straightforward. There are also self-service ticket machines, which are accessible and located at the entrance to platform 2. The station supports passengers with hearing impairments with induction loops and provides customer help points for added assistance. Even though there are no accessible toilets, the station ensures step-free access throughout, with ramps available for boarding trains.
Security and peace of mind are assured with CCTV surveillance, and while waiting, passengers can utilize the waiting rooms, open from early morning through to the evening. Treat yourself at available refreshment facilities and shops or connect to the "GWR Free Station WiFi" to stay online. While ATM facilities aren't available, other essentials are well catered to.
St Austell station is exceptionally well-connected with various transportation options. Whether you're catching east and westbound buses, with services available from the station car park and the bus station respectively, or hailing a taxi right from the station, your onward journey is easy and hassle-free.
